Appease

Appease verb - To lessen the anger or agitation of.
Usage example: candy often appeases an upset toddler

Bother is an antonym for appease.

Bother

Bother verb - To thrust oneself upon (another) without invitation.
Usage example: I am never going to get this work done if people don't stop wandering into the room and bothering me

Appease is an antonym for bother in harass topic.
